Understanding Misty Glass Repair: Transforming Cloudy Windows into Clear Views
Misty glass is a typical problem that lots of house owners and entrepreneur encounter, especially in older properties. This phenomenon occurs when condensation develops up between double-glazed window panes, producing a cloudy look that blocks views and decreases curb appeal. If you're facing this issue, comprehending misty glass repair procedures can help you restore your windows to their previous splendor. This detailed guide will stroll you through the reasons for misty glass, repair options, expenses, and frequently asked questions.
What Causes Misty Glass?
Misty glass normally happens due to a breakdown of the seal in between Double Glazing Fog-glazed panes. Here are some common causes:

When it comes to Repairing Misted Windows misty glass, property owners have a number of options. These vary in regards to cost, effectiveness, and long-term results.
1. Glass ReplacementProsConsLong-term serviceHigher expensesEnhanced insulationTime-consumingBoosted aesthetic appealsRequires professional help
Changing the whole double-glazed system is often the most efficient long-lasting solution. This alternative includes getting rid of the old window and installing a brand-new one, which typically resolves any concerns associated with moisture and presence.
2. Defogging ServicesProsConsCost-effectiveTemporary serviceQuick turnaroundMight not restore full clarityLess invasiveThreat of future issues
Defogging is an increasing trend in window repair. It includes drilling small holes into the framed glass and utilizing specialized tools to eliminate the moisture and use an option that avoids further misting. While cost-effective, this approach is mostly a short-term fix.

Cost of Misty Glass Repair
The cost of misty glass repair differs commonly based on the picked technique. Here's a rough breakdown:
Repair MethodTypical Cost RangeGlass Replacement₤ 300 - ₤ 700 per unitDefogging Services₤ 50 - ₤ 150 per paneDIY Solutions₤ 10 - ₤ 50 for materials
When choosing a repair alternative, consider the long-term implications and prospective savings in energy costs.
